Established in 1824, the University of Manchester is the largest single-site university in the UK and a part of the prestigious Russell Group of universities. In 2025, the University of Manchester was ranked by QS as the 7th Best University in the UK, 11th Best University in Europe, and 35th in the QS World University Rankings 2026.
Note that the university is the most popular in the UK for UG applications (UCAS 2023 cycle), and it is the second most targeted university by the employers by the UK's leading employers according to the Graduate Market 2025. Times Higher Education ranked the University of Manchester #53 in the World, and it is the only university in the world to have been ranked amongst the top ten for social and environmental impact every year by the THE Impact Rankings.

University of Manchester Acceptance Rate 2025
The University of Manchester houses over 44,000 students, as per data provided by the Russel Group, and of these, around 26,000 students are undergraduates, while 14,000+ students enrolled are graduates. The University of Manchester acceptance rate stands at around 39%, suggesting that the university's admission criteria are moderately selective.

University of Manchester Acceptance Rate for UG Students
As per the UCAS end-of-cycle data for undergraduates, the university received over 92,500 applications from prospective students for 2024, of which the university accepted almost 10,000 applicants. This suggests that the University of Manchester acceptance rate for UG students is a mere 10.7%

The University of Manchester provides top-notch education across various fields. The enrollment data and subject-wise acceptance rates for 2024 for the top 10 popular subjects amongst undergraduate students at the university are given as follows:
Subject Group |
UG Applications Received |
UG Applicants Accepted |
University of Manchester Acceptance Rate |
---|
Business and Management |
12,940 |
1,135 |
8.7% |
Subjects Allied to Medicine |
12,665 |
1,040 |
8.2% |
Social Sciences |
12,585 |
1,320 |
10.4% |
Engineering and Technology |
10,520 |
1,145 |
10.8% |
Medicine and Dentistry |
4,940 |
655 |
13.2% |
Law |
4,830 |
385 |
7.9% |
Historical, Philosophical and Religious Studies |
4,100 |
575 |
14% |
Computing |
4,095 |
380 |
9.2% |
Psychology |
4,080 |
410 |
10% |
Mathematical Sciences |
3,785 |
460 |
12.1% |
(Source: UCAS Undergraduate end-of-cycle data resources 2024)

University of Manchester Acceptance Rate for International Students
Manchester’s international student enrollment is one of the largest amongst UK universities. Currently, the University of Manchester campus houses almost 14,500 international students representing over 170 nationalities. Having the biggest global alumni community for a campus-based UK university, the number of former students crosses 550,000, representing over 190 countries.
Moreover, of the total enrolled student body at the University of Manchester, international students account for 25% of the total, and the university houses around 1,500 Indian-origin students and 1,700 students in total hailing from countries across South Asia.

The University of Manchester received almost 37,000 applications from prospective UG students for 2024, of which the university admitted 3,600 candidates, suggesting that the UG University of Manchester acceptance rate for international students is 9.8%.

According to the data reported by the Higher Education Statistics Agency (HESA) for 2023-24, the University of Manchester student enrollment records reveal that the number of international students at the university has decreased by over 4,000 as compared to the previous year. Earlier, the trends seemed to be increasing; however, a sudden drop in international enrollment could point to increased selectivity of the admission criteria for international students.
Academic Year
|
International Students
|
---|
2024-25
|
Almost 14,500 |
2023-24
|
18,660
|
2022-23
|
18,515
|
2021-22
|
18,170
|
2020-21
|
17,625
|
2019-20
|
15,335
|
(Source: HESA, official university website for 2024-25 figure)

University of Manchester Acceptance Rate Trends
The University of Manchester has been receiving an increased number of applications over the years from prospective UG students over the years; however, the number of applicants accepted has been gradually declining. As a result, the University of Manchester acceptance rate for UG students has been slowly decreasing, going from 13.6% in 2020 down to 10.7% in 2024. This points to increasing selectivity of the admission criteria of the university.
Year |
UG Applications Received |
UG Applicants Accepted |
Manchester Acceptance Rate |
---|
2024 |
92,500 |
9,985 |
10.79% |
2023 |
93,450 |
9,630 |
10.30% |
2022 |
92,310 |
9,600 |
10.40% |
2021 |
88,330 |
11,070 |
12.53% |
2020 |
79,925 |
10,925 |
13.67% |
(Source: UCAS Undergraduate end-of-cycle data resources 2024)
When it comes to the statistics for the international students, the university has been receiving an increased number of applications from international UG students as well. On the other hand, the number of students admitted has also been slowly decreasing over the years, consequently making the UG University of Manchester acceptance rate drop from 14.2% in 2020 to 9.8% in 2024. Refer to the table given below for exact statsitics:
Year |
UG International Applications Received |
UG International Applicants Accepted |
Manchester Acceptance Rate |
---|
2024 |
36,990 |
3,630 |
9.81% |
2023 |
35,240 |
3,340 |
9.48% |
2022 |
34,145 |
3,300 |
9.66% |
2021 |
31,960 |
3,455 |
10,81% |
2020 |
29,195 |
4,160 |
14.25% |
University of Manchester Admission Requirements for Indian Students
The Uni of Manchester admission requirements for Indian students vary for UG and PG students. These are given as follows:
UG
- Students who have completed a Higher Secondary School Certificate from CBSE / ISC (Class 12) must have achieved a minimum of 80-95% overall. Also, note that the specified minimum requirements may vary depending on the chosen course
- Students achieving an overall Class 12 grade of 70% or higher (with a minimum of 75% in Mathematics and Physics and 65% in English) would be considered for the university's Science and Engineering program with an integrated foundation year. Applications for the university's Bioscience with a foundation year program would be considered following the completion of Class 12 HSC on a case-by-case basis
- Students passing Class 12 from the State Boards of West Bengal, Maharashtra, Karnataka, Tamil Nadu, and Gujarat should also have 80-95% overall. Note that the applications from State boards shall not be considered for Medicine
PG
- MSC, MA, MRes: The applicants are required to have a minimum of a 3-year degree and have obtained a first-class position from a reputable university. Overall 60% - 80% is required
- MBA: The Uni of Manchester MBA requires applicants to have a minimum of 3 years' professional work experience plus a good UG degree
- PhD: Those applicants who have completed a minimum of a 3-year degree and obtained a first class at a reputable university are considered for PhDs

Tips to Get Selected at the University of Manchester
- Check Course-Specific Requirements- Basic requirements like English language proficiency proof, higher secondary school scores, LORs, etc., will vary based on the course of choice of the student. Thus, it is advised to check the official MU website to make sure one meets the eligibility criteria.
- Improve Academic Profile- Although not the sole determinant, academic record is one of the major factors of evaluation used by the University of Manchester. Therefore, the earlier students start improving their high school scores, the better.
- Improve English Language Proficiency- Much like any study abroad university, MU also requires its international applicants from non-English speaking countries to provide proof of English language ability. Thus, students are advised to work on the same early on instead of hustling or mugging up the expected questions at the last moment.
- Be mindful of Deadlines- Be good at time management and adhere to the deadlines dictated by the university.
